Subject: Key rotation — Renderloom perf service

Hi folks, quick heads-up for release managers: we're rotating credentials for Renderloom, the internal service that benchmarks template rendering performance before each release. The old key stops working Friday, so update your release scripts before then or the perf gate will fail and block your cut. Nothing else changes — same endpoint, same payloads. The new key for the perf gate is below.

gateway credential: kto3_qfe

# Managers Only: Atlascend "Summit" Tier

This page covers the new Summit subscription tier launching next quarter. Sales leads: Summit bundles priority provisioning, the Lumenpath analytics add-on, and dedicated onboarding. Pricing sits 40% above Pinnacle and is not discountable below 10% without director sign-off. Pitch Summit only to accounts over the usage threshold in the qualification sheet. Do not share tier details externally before launch. Strategic context is in the confidential note below.

board note of bawep-tajef: Queniusek Systems plans to raise the Quenvan list price by 53.1 percent in March. The pricing group signed off on a budget of $176.4 million for Project Drueth. The renewal with Casionix Partners closes at $142.5 million a year, 8.3 percent below the last contract. Project Fraax slips by six weeks because of the tooling delay.

## Ownership

The Snapgrist thumbnail generation queue is owned by the Media Infra group. Release gating: do not ship queue worker changes without a passing backlog drain test. Capacity bumps require sign-off. Rollbacks are safe; the queue is idempotent. Dashboards live in the Snapgrist ops folder. For release approvals, paging, or anything blocking a cut, the responsible owner is named below.

named custodian: Brivan Eliath Quenox Frador

## Deployment

The Centivault conversion service deploys as a pair of replicas behind the Moorgate proxy. All currency math runs in fixed-point with banker's rounding; the older float path caused the drift documented in the postmortem for release 2.3 and must stay disabled. Deploys are blue-green, and the reconciliation job should be paused during cut-over to avoid double-counting the rounding ledger. Resume it only after both replicas report healthy. The runtime configuration applied on boot is as follows.

deployment values, kajep-kageg:
[praix]
host = praix.paliqcorp.corp
user = praix_svc
database = praix_prod